Soffit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Soffit repair services focus on restoring the underside of the roof overhang, which is essential for proper ventilation, protection from pests, and overall curb appeal. These repairs can address issues such as sagging, cracks, holes, or water damage, often caused by weather exposure or age. Homeowners typically request soffit repairs when noticing signs of deterioration, including peeling paint, mold, or the presence of pests, to maintain the integrity of their roofing system and prevent further damage.
Before requesting soffit rep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age and whether the affected area requires only patching or a full replacement. It's also helpful to consider the material of the existing soffit, such as vinyl, aluminum, or wood, as different materials may require specific repair approaches. Ensuring proper ventilation and addressing underlying issues like leaks or roof damage can be important steps in the repair process to help prolong the lifespan of the soffit and maintain the home's exterior appearance.

Soffit Repair Questions
What is soffit repair? Soffit repair involves fixing or replacing the underside of eaves to prevent damage and improve appearance.
When should soffit repair be considered? Signs like sagging, cracks, or water damage indicate that soffit repair may be needed.
What are common causes of soffit damage? Damage often results from pests, weather exposure, or age-related wear and tear.
Does soffit repair affect home ventilation? Proper soffit repair maintains proper attic ventilation and helps prevent moisture buildup.
